I suspect the turbo is dead and this is what I would do to verify that.

1. Make sure the actuator arm is still connected.

2. Disconnect the vacuum hose to the actuator and test run. If problem persists, check the turbo for seizing, shaft play and licp for oil. If problem solved, go to 3.

3. Connect the pressure source directly to the actuator and test run. If problem persists, you have an actuator that opens prematurely. If problem solved, the mbc is in question.

4. Most importantly, perform a boost leak test and compression test to determine what's causing the -10 HG at idle. You should do these tests regardless the results of 1, 2 and 3.

Post back results and we'll go from there. Good luck.

mbc= manual boost controller. What brand and what type is it? Describe how the to and from hoses are connected to it.

afpr= adjustable fuel pressure regulator. You need this because the 255 pump will over run your stock regulator and make you run rich pretty much whenever you're not boosting over 5psi.

When you said "you check the boost leak test", does it man this http://www.vfaq.com/mods/ICtester.html or just a visual inspection? Make sure you do the leak test, it's the number cause of the problem you're describing.
